Annual SSA, SSC & SYLA Lecture
Tuesday, 2nd December 2014 at 6pm.
Joint event between the SSC Society, The SYLA and the Society of Solicitor Advocates.
Sheriff Principal Mhairi Stephen will give a talk entitled "The Sheriff Court – the future" in Court 1, Parliament House.
This lecture is open to all solicitors, members of faculty, trainee’s and law students. CPD points are available, provided anyone wishing to claim CPD points, signs the Sederunt Book. We should be grateful if Attendee’s can be seated by 5:55pm
After the talk, supper will be served in the SSC Library, for which the charge is £15.
Bookings for this event and the supper to follow (£15 per head) can be made through www.eventbrite.co.uk or for SSC Members by contacting the SSC Library.
We advise that early booking is essential for both the lecture and the supper.
